Warming will increase after the weekend

The first element of consensus today is the gradual return of warmer weather after the July 4th and 5th weekend.

After a few breathable days, the anticyclone should rise again over Western Europe, contributing to the rise of subtropical air from the Iberian Peninsula and Maghreb. Temperatures will therefore begin to rise again across much of France, first in the south and then towards the center of the country.

In this regard, the main forecasting models are relatively well agreed upon.

Two different scenarios for next week

Especially from Monday, July 6th, differences become apparent.

The US GFS model currently favors a particularly hot scenario. He sees a new wave of Saharan air quickly reaching France with anomalies locally exceeding +15-+17°C at an altitude of about 1500 meters. In this configuration, temperatures in many regions could again reach or even exceed 35°C, with the risk of a heat wave if the heat wave continues for several days.

Conversely, the European CEP (IFS) model suggests a more moderate scenario. The heat will be present, especially in the southern half and center of the country, but the influence of the ocean will be more persistent near the English Channel and in the north-west. Then extreme heat will be less common and likely shorter lasting.

The differences relate to intensity… but most of all, duration.

Contrary to what we may read on some social media, the patterns are not completely opposite.

Now everyone expects the temperature to rise further. On the other hand, they still differ greatly in three main ways:

– heating intensity
– its geographical distribution
– its duration

However, it is these three criteria that qualify an episode as a heat wave or heat wave.

It is therefore too early at this stage to announce with certainty a new episode comparable to the one we have just experienced.

Can we already talk about a heat wave?

Even if some scenarios are becoming more favorable for another heat wave, it is still too early to talk about a heat wave for the week ahead.

The reliability of the model decreases significantly after five to seven days, especially when the forecast depends on the precise location of centers of action and Atlantic depressions.

On the other hand, the signal for continued very hot weather, especially in the south and west from the beginning of next week, is gradually strengthening. The next few days will determine whether this heat wave becomes a new heat wave in the country.
